4c0aa60871 A subset of the original v4 patch (which will become v5 eventually)
The main operational difference is that for v4 effect onward, the 
sound name will now be *TRACK*.  This will not affect existing
effects since they use version number 3 or less.

This also provides the Nyquist effect with much more information about
the current processing:

Variable       Property    What
*AUDACITY*     VERSION     current Audacity version number

*SYSTEM-DIR*   BASE        Audacity install path
*SYSTEM-DIR*   DATA        Audacity data path
*SYSTEM-DIR*   HELP        Audacity help path
*SYSTEM-DIR*   TEMP        Audacity temp file path
*SYSTEM-DIR*   PLUGIN      Audacity search path for Nyquist plugins

*PROJECT*      RATE        current project sample rate
*PROJECT*      TRACKS      total number of tracks in the project
*PROJECT*      WAVETRACKS  number of wave tracks in the project
*PROJECT*      LABELTRACKS number of label tracks in the project
*PROJECT*      MIDITRACKS  number of midi tracks in the project
*PROJECT*      TIMETRACKS  number of time tracks in the project

*SELECTION*    START       start time of current selection
*SELECTION*    END         end time of current selection
*SELECTION*    TRACKS      number of tracks in the current selection
*SELECTION*    CHANNELS    number of channels in the current selection
*SELECTION*    LOW-HZ      low frequency from spectrogram (if available, else nil)
*SELECTION*    CENTER-HZ   center frequence (calculated) (if available, else nil)
*SELECTION*    HIGH-HZ     high frequence from spectrogram (if available, else nil)
*SELECTION*    BANDWIDTH   bandwidth in octaves (calculated) (if available, else nil)
*SELECTION*    PEAK-LEVEL  peak amplitude for the current selection

*TRACK*        INDEX       1-based index of track being processed
*TRACK*        NAME        name of track
*TRACK*        TYPE        type of track: wave, midi, label, time
*TRACK*        VIEW        track view: Waveform,  Waveform (dB), etc.
*TRACK*        CHANNELS    number of channels in the track
*TRACK*        START-TIME  start time of track
*TRACK*        END-TIME    end time of track
*TRACK*        GAIN        track gain
*TRACK*        PAN         track pan
*TRACK*        RATE        sample rate of track
*TRACK*        FORMAT      sample format: 16 (int), 24 (int), 32.0 (float)
*TRACK*        CLIPS       list of start/end times for clips for each channel

"The functions wxString::Format, wxString::Printf (and others indirectly) have become stricter about parameter types that don't match (format specifier vs. function parameters). So the bugs (that were already present in audacity before) become visible in wx3.0 as error message dialogs. I've checked all occurrences of Printf, wxPrintf, PrintfV, Format, FormatV, wxLogDebug and wxLogError systematically and made the type match."

Note (9/15): In TrackPanel.cpp, ExportMP2.cpp and CompareAudioCommand.cpp this patch supersedes related change done in r13466 because the new solution requires fewer casts and therefore simplifies the code.

Note: Many .po files are affected, and we need to be very careful about this.  Incorrect "%d" and similar in translation files may lead to crashes in those languages (only).  This is something we should actually have been more careful about in the past.  We need to write a script to check that the "%d" and similar format specifiers match between English and translation.

c6ffa89d23 Add (restore?) the ability to build without trashing the source tree
You may now do:

mkdir build
cd build
../configure
./audacity

And all but one directory will remain unmolested...no more object files
in "src".

And if you look carefully, you'll see that the newly built "audacity" is
copied to the top of the build tree...no more having to use "src/audacity"
to run.

You can of course still do the configure from the top and get all of the
objects strewn about the tree.

I still haven't figured out how to keep the locale directory from getting
soiled.  I'm not really sure there's a way around it really.
